Find the Right Vacation Rental with Safety-First Filters

Once you’ve narrowed down your destination, it’s time for lodging. Vacation rentals and holiday rentals can be incredible for families because they offer space, kitchens, and a home-like routine—yet safety and convenience still come first.

When searching, look for SEO-strong listings or guides that clearly describe safety-relevant details. Not every listing will mention everything you care about, but strong documentation is a helpful indicator of transparency. Consider focusing on:

  • Secure entrances and exterior lighting: Especially important if you’ll arrive at night or come back after evening activities.
  • Stair and balcony safety: For families with toddlers and young kids, clearly described stair railings, balcony access, and childproofing options matter.
  • Kitchen readiness: A full kitchen with sharp knives stored appropriately, stove safety, and appliance safety can reduce everyday stress.
  • Laundry availability: In many families, laundry is not a “nice-to-have”—it’s essential. It can cut down on packing and help you maintain routines.
  • Parking and street safety: Search for “parking included” or “private driveway” to avoid complicated street parking with kids.
  • Distance to essentials: Grocery stores, pharmacies, urgent care, and family-friendly attractions should be reasonably accessible.

Using these filters not only improves your comfort—it reduces uncertainty. SEO can assist by surfacing listings that include these details in plain language.

Use Reviews and FAQs Like a Safety Checklist

SEO does more than improve visibility—it also helps listings and guides present structured details like FAQs and organized amenity sections. When you review vacation rental listings, use those sections as a checklist.

Pay attention to:

  • Communication and check-in clarity: Families benefit from clear instructions and responsive hosts.
  • Accuracy of photos and descriptions: Reliable listings often match real conditions.
  • Noise considerations: If your kids need naps or early bedtime, look for mention of nearby roads, nightlife, or thin walls.
  • Maintenance signals: Reviews that mention cleanliness, working appliances, and easy-to-use amenities often indicate better day-to-day comfort.
  • Safety-related concerns: For example, steep stairs, lack of railings, or unclear lock mechanisms should not be ignored.

When SEO-driven content clearly answers common questions, you spend less time guessing and more time enjoying your trip. That directly supports safer, calmer travel.
